VPS测速文件有哪些?_全面解析VPS测速文件的类型与使用方法

VPS测速文件有哪些类型和使用方法?

测速文件类型 文件大小 适用场景 主要特点
100MB测速文件 100MB 基础带宽测试 下载速度快,测试时间短
1GB测速文件 1GB 大流量测试 测试结果更准确
10GB测速文件 10GB 极限压力测试 适合大带宽服务器测试
4K小文件 4KB IOPS性能测试 测试硬盘读写性能
自定义大小文件 可调整 灵活测试 根据需求定制

VPS测速文件的全面指南

在VPS性能评估过程中,测速文件起着至关重要的作用。通过下载特定大小的文件,用户可以准确测量服务器的网络带宽、响应时间和稳定性表现。

主要测速文件类型及用途

文件类型 常见格式 主要用途 优势特点
标准测速文件 .bin格式 基础带宽测试 文件纯净,无安全隐患
压缩包文件 .zip/.tar.gz 综合性能测试 模拟真实应用场景
镜像源文件 各格式文件 实际应用测试 测试真实使用效果
脚本生成文件 临时生成 灵活定制测试 可根据需求调整大小

详细操作步骤

步骤一:生成测速文件

操作说明: 使用dd命令在VPS上生成指定大小的测速文件,这种方法简单快捷且不需要额外安装软件。 使用工具提示
  • Linux系统内置dd命令
  • 需要root或sudo权限
  • 确保磁盘空间充足
# 生成100MB测速文件
dd if=/dev/zero of=100mb.bin bs=100M count=1

生成1GB测速文件

dd if=/dev/zero of=1gb.bin bs=1G count=1

生成10GB测速文件

dd if=/dev/zero of=10gb.bin bs=1G count=10

步骤二:配置Web服务器

操作说明: 将生成的测速文件放置在Web服务器目录下,配置正确的访问权限。 使用工具提示
  • Nginx或Apache
  • 确保防火墙设置正确
  • 配置适当的缓存策略
# 将文件移动到Web目录
mv 100mb.bin /var/www/html/

设置文件权限

chmod 644 /var/www/html/100mb.bin

步骤三:执行测速测试

操作说明: 使用wget或curl命令从不同位置下载测速文件,记录下载速度和时间。 使用工具提示
  • wget或curl工具
  • 计时工具
  • 网络监控工具
# 使用wget测试下载速度
wget -O /dev/null http://your-server-ip/100mb.bin

使用curl测试下载速度

curl -o /dev/null http://your-server-ip/100mb.bin

步骤四:使用专业测速脚本

操作说明: 部署专业的测速脚本,如LibreSpeed,提供更全面的测试功能。 使用工具提示
  • Docker环境
  • Docker Compose工具
  • Nginx反向代理
# 使用Docker部署LibreSpeed
docker run -d -p 80:80 ghcr.io/librespeed/speedtest

常见问题及解决方案

问题 可能原因 解决方案
测速文件下载速度不稳定 网络拥塞或路由问题 使用多节点测试,选择最优线路
生成大文件时磁盘空间不足 服务器存储容量限制 检查磁盘空间,清理不必要的文件
测速结果显示异常 服务器负载过高 在服务器空闲时段重新测试
无法通过Web访问测速文件 防火墙或权限设置问题 检查防火墙规则和文件权限
不同工具测试结果差异大 测试方法和参数不同 统一测试工具和参数设置

高级测速技巧

多节点并发测试

通过在不同地理位置的服务器上同时下载测速文件,可以全面评估VPS的网络性能表现。通过测试到中国电信、联通、移动等不同网络节点的速度,能够更准确地判断服务器的线路质量。

自定义测速文件

根据实际需求生成不同大小的测速文件,可以更精准地测试特定应用场景下的性能表现。

实时监控分析

在测速过程中实时监控服务器的CPU、内存和网络使用情况,有助于发现性能瓶颈和优化方向。 通过合理使用VPS测速文件,用户可以全面了解服务器的网络性能,为业务部署和优化提供重要参考依据。不同的测速文件类型适用于不同的测试场景,选择合适的测速方案能够获得更准确的测试结果。

发表评论

评论列表